Beaver Softball is Ready to Face Northwest Tech

The Beaver softball team is set to host the Northwest Tech Mavericks on March 8. The first pitch is set for 2:00 pm for the double header at Angood Field. The Beavers enter tomorrow's contest off two losses at home against Barton. In game two, the Beavers built a four-run lead through the first three innings. In the fourth inning, the Cougars tied the game up and ended up scoring a run in the fifth, sixth, and seventh inning to win the game 7-4.  

Pratt also faced Butler County on the road last week. The team lost both games but were competitive in game one, only losing 7-1. Northwest Tech enters tomorrow's series sitting 0-8 overall with losing conference series against Cloud, Dodge City, and Garden City. Heavan Carreon leads the team with a .385 batting average with five hits including a double, one RBI, and two stolen bases.  

The team will travel to Cowley on March 10 before hosting Dodge City at Angood Field on March 11.
